Hbase+Hadoop安装部署
VMware安装多个RedHat Linux操作系统,摘抄了不少网上的资料,基本上按照顺序都能安装好 ? 1、建用户 groupadd bigdata useradd -g bigdata hadoop passwd hadoop ? 2、建JDK vi /etc/profile ? export JAVA_HOME=/usr/lib/java-1.7.0_07 export CLASSPATH=.
VMware安装多个RedHat Linux操作系统,摘抄了不少网上的资料,基本上按照顺序都能安装好
?
1、建用户
groupadd bigdata
useradd -g bigdata hadoop
passwd hadoop
?
2、建JDK
vi /etc/profile
?
export JAVA_HOME=/usr/lib/java-1.7.0_07
export CLASSPATH=.
export HADOOP_HOME=/home/hadoop/hadoop
export HBASE_HOME=/home/hadoop/hbase?
export HADOOP_MAPARED_HOME=${HADOOP_HOME}
export HADOOP_COMMON_HOME=${HADOOP_HOME}
export HADOOP_HDFS_HOME=${HADOOP_HOME}
export YARN_HOME=${HADOOP_HOME}
export HADOOP_CONF_DIR=${HADOOP_HOME}/etc/hadoop
export HDFS_CONF_DIR=${HADOOP_HOME}/etc/hadoop
export YARN_CONF_DIR=${HADOOP_HOME}/etc/hadoop
export HBASE_CONF_DIR=${HBASE_HOME}/conf
export ZK_HOME=/home/hadoop/zookeeper
export PATH=$JAVA_HOME/bin:$HADOOP_HOME/bin:$HBASE_HOME/bin:$HADOOP_HOME/sbin:$ZK_HOME/bin:$PATH
?
?
?
?
?
source /etc/profile
chmod 777 -R /usr/lib/java-1.7.0_07
?
?
3、修改hosts
vi /etc/hosts
加入
172.16.254.215 ? master
172.16.254.216 ? salve1
172.16.254.217 ? salve2
172.16.254.218 ? salve3
?
3、免ssh密码
215服务器
su -root
vi /etc/ssh/sshd_config
确保含有如下内容
RSAAuthentication yes
PubkeyAuthentication yes
AuthorizedKeysFile ? ? ?.ssh/authorized_keys
重启sshd
service sshd restart
?
su - hadoop
ssh-keygen -t rsa
cd /home/hadoop/.ssh
cat id_rsa.pub >> authorized_keys
chmod 600 authorized_keys
?
在217 ?218 ?216 分别执行?
mkdir /home/hadoop/.ssh
chmod 700 /home/hadoop/.ssh
?
在215上执行
scp id_rsa.pub hadoop@salve1:/home/hadoop/.ssh/
scp id_rsa.pub hadoop@salve2:/home/hadoop/.ssh/
scp id_rsa.pub hadoop@salve3:/home/hadoop/.ssh/
?
在217 ?218 ?216 分别执行?
cat /home/hadoop/.ssh/id_rsa.pub >> /home/hadoop/.ssh/authorized_keys?
chmod 600 /home/hadoop/.ssh//authorized_keys
?
?
4、建hadoop与hbase、zookeeper
su - hadoop
mkdir /home/hadoop/hadoop
mkdir /home/hadoop/hbase
mkdir /home/hadoop/zookeeper
?
cp -r /home/hadoop/soft/hadoop-2.0.1-alpha/* /home/hadoop/hadoop/
cp -r /home/hadoop/soft/hbase-0.95.0-hadoop2/* /home/hadoop/hbase/
cp -r /home/hadoop/soft/zookeeper-3.4.5/* /home/hadoop/zookeeper/
?
?
1) hadoop 配置
?
vi /home/hadoop/hadoop/etc/hadoop/hadoop-env.sh?
修改?
export JAVA_HOME=/usr/lib/java-1.7.0_07
export HBASE_MANAGES_ZK=true
?
?
vi /home/hadoop/hadoop/etc/hadoop/core-site.xml
加入
?
vi /home/hadoop/hadoop/etc/hadoop/slaves ?
加入(不用master做salve)
salve1
salve2
salve3
?
vi /home/hadoop/hadoop/etc/hadoop/hdfs-site.xml
加入
?
?
?
?
?
?
?
?
?
?
?
?
?
?
?
vi /home/hadoop/hadoop/etc/hadoop/yarn-site.xml
加入
?
?
?
?
?
?
2) hbase配置
?
vi /home/hadoop/hbase/conf/hbase-site.xml
加入
?
?
?
?
?
?
vi /home/hadoop/hbase/conf/regionservers
加入
salve1
salve2
salve3
?
vi /home/hadoop/hbase/conf/hbase-env.sh
修改
export JAVA_HOME=/usr/lib/java-1.7.0_07
export HBASE_MANAGES_ZK=false
?
?
?
3) zookeeper配置
?
vi /home/hadoop/zookeeper/conf/zoo.cfg
加入
tickTime=2000
initLimit=10
syncLimit=5
dataDir=/home/hadoop/zookeeper/data
clientPort=2181
server.1=salve1:2888:3888
server.2=salve2:2888:3888
server.3=salve3:2888:3888
?
将/home/hadoop/zookeeper/conf/zoo.cfg拷贝到/home/hadoop/hbase/
?
?
4) 同步master和salve
scp -r /home/hadoop/hadoop ?hadoop@salve1:/home/hadoop ?
scp -r /home/hadoop/hbase ?hadoop@salve1:/home/hadoop ?
scp -r /home/hadoop/zookeeper ?hadoop@salve1:/home/hadoop
?
scp -r /home/hadoop/hadoop ?hadoop@salve2:/home/hadoop ?
scp -r /home/hadoop/hbase ?hadoop@salve2:/home/hadoop ?
scp -r /home/hadoop/zookeeper ?hadoop@salve2:/home/hadoop
?
scp -r /home/hadoop/hadoop ?hadoop@salve3:/home/hadoop ?
scp -r /home/hadoop/hbase ?hadoop@salve3:/home/hadoop ?
scp -r /home/hadoop/zookeeper ?hadoop@salve3:/home/hadoop
?
设置 salve1 salve2 salve3 的zookeeper
?
echo "1" > /home/hadoop/zookeeper/data/myid
echo "2" > /home/hadoop/zookeeper/data/myid
echo "3" > /home/hadoop/zookeeper/data/myid
?
?
?
5)测试
测试hadoop
hadoop namenode -format -clusterid clustername
?
start-all.sh
hadoop fs -ls hdfs://172.16.254.215:9000/?
hadoop fs -mkdir hdfs://172.16.254.215:9000/hbase?
//hadoop fs -copyFromLocal ./install.log hdfs://172.16.254.215:9000/testfolder?
//hadoop fs -ls hdfs://172.16.254.215:9000/testfolder
//hadoop fs -put /usr/hadoop/hadoop-2.0.1-alpha/*.txt hdfs://172.16.254.215:9000/testfolder
//cd /usr/hadoop/hadoop-2.0.1-alpha/share/hadoop/mapreduce
//hadoop jar hadoop-mapreduce-examples-2.0.1-alpha.jar wordcount hdfs://172.16.254.215:9000/testfolder hdfs://172.16.254.215:9000/output
//hadoop fs -ls hdfs://172.16.254.215:9000/output
//hadoop fs -cat ?hdfs://172.16.254.215:9000/output/part-r-00000
?
启动 salve1 salve2 salve3 的zookeeper
zkServer.sh start
?
启动 start-hbase.sh
进入 hbase shell
测试 hbase?
list
create 'student','name','address' ?
put 'student','1','name','tom'
get 'student','1'
?
已有 0 人发表留言,猛击->> 这里
ITeye推荐
- —软件人才免语言低担保 赴美带薪读研!—
原文地址:Hbase+Hadoop安装部署, 感谢原作者分享。

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

Video Face Swap
Tauschen Sie Gesichter in jedem Video mühelos mit unserem völlig kostenlosen KI-Gesichtstausch-Tool aus!

Heißer Artikel

Heiße Werkzeuge

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en

Lösung für das Problem, dass das Win11-System das chinesische Sprachpaket nicht installieren kann. Mit der Einführung des Windows 11-Systems begannen viele Benutzer, ihr Betriebssystem zu aktualisieren, um neue Funktionen und Schnittstellen zu nutzen. Einige Benutzer stellten jedoch fest, dass sie das chinesische Sprachpaket nach dem Upgrade nicht installieren konnten, was ihre Erfahrung beeinträchtigte. In diesem Artikel besprechen wir die Gründe, warum das Win11-System das chinesische Sprachpaket nicht installieren kann, und stellen einige Lösungen bereit, die Benutzern bei der Lösung dieses Problems helfen. Ursachenanalyse Lassen Sie uns zunächst die Unfähigkeit des Win11-Systems analysieren

Möglicherweise können Sie keine Gastzusätze zu einer virtuellen Maschine in OracleVirtualBox installieren. Wenn wir auf Geräte>InstallGuestAdditionsCDImage klicken, wird einfach ein Fehler wie unten gezeigt ausgegeben: VirtualBox – Fehler: Virtuelles Laufwerk C kann nicht eingefügt werden: DateienOracleVirtualBoxVBoxGuestAdditions.iso in die Ubuntu-Maschine programmieren In diesem Beitrag werden wir verstehen, was passiert, wenn Sie. Was zu tun ist, wenn Sie Gastzusätze können in VirtualBox nicht installiert werden. Gastzusätze können nicht in VirtualBox installiert werden. Wenn Sie es nicht in Virtua installieren können

Wenn Sie die Installationsdatei von Baidu Netdisk erfolgreich heruntergeladen haben, sie aber nicht normal installieren können, liegt möglicherweise ein Fehler in der Integrität der Softwaredatei vor oder es liegt ein Problem mit den verbleibenden Dateien und Registrierungseinträgen vor Lassen Sie uns die Analyse des Problems vorstellen, dass Baidu Netdisk erfolgreich heruntergeladen, aber nicht installiert werden kann. Analyse des Problems, dass Baidu Netdisk erfolgreich heruntergeladen, aber nicht installiert werden konnte 1. Überprüfen Sie die Integrität der Installationsdatei: Stellen Sie sicher, dass die heruntergeladene Installationsdatei vollständig und nicht beschädigt ist. Sie können es erneut herunterladen oder versuchen, die Installationsdatei von einer anderen vertrauenswürdigen Quelle herunterzuladen. 2. Deaktivieren Sie Antivirensoftware und Firewall: Einige Antivirensoftware oder Firewallprogramme verhindern möglicherweise die ordnungsgemäße Ausführung des Installationsprogramms. Versuchen Sie, die Antivirensoftware und die Firewall zu deaktivieren oder zu beenden, und führen Sie dann die Installation erneut aus

Die Installation von Android-Anwendungen unter Linux war für viele Benutzer schon immer ein Problem. Insbesondere für Linux-Benutzer, die gerne Android-Anwendungen verwenden, ist es sehr wichtig, die Installation von Android-Anwendungen auf Linux-Systemen zu beherrschen. Obwohl die direkte Ausführung von Android-Anwendungen unter Linux nicht so einfach ist wie auf der Android-Plattform, können wir mithilfe von Emulatoren oder Tools von Drittanbietern Android-Anwendungen unter Linux dennoch problemlos genießen. Im Folgenden wird erläutert, wie Android-Anwendungen auf Linux-Systemen installiert werden.

Wenn Sie Docker verwendet haben, müssen Sie Daemons, Container und ihre Funktionen verstehen. Ein Daemon ist ein Dienst, der im Hintergrund läuft, wenn ein Container bereits in einem System verwendet wird. Podman ist ein kostenloses Verwaltungstool zum Verwalten und Erstellen von Containern, ohne auf einen Daemon wie Docker angewiesen zu sein. Daher bietet es Vorteile bei der Verwaltung von Containern, ohne dass langfristige Backend-Dienste erforderlich sind. Darüber hinaus erfordert Podman keine Root-Berechtigungen. In dieser Anleitung wird ausführlich erläutert, wie Sie Podman auf Ubuntu24 installieren. Um das System zu aktualisieren, müssen wir zunächst das System aktualisieren und die Terminal-Shell von Ubuntu24 öffnen. Sowohl während des Installations- als auch des Upgrade-Vorgangs müssen wir die Befehlszeile verwenden. eine einfache

Während des Lernens in der Oberstufe machen sich einige Schüler sehr klare und genaue Notizen und machen sich mehr Notizen als andere in derselben Klasse. Für manche ist das Notieren ein Hobby, für andere ist es eine Notwendigkeit, wenn sie leicht kleine Informationen über etwas Wichtiges vergessen. Die NTFS-Anwendung von Microsoft ist besonders nützlich für Studierende, die wichtige Notizen außerhalb der regulären Vorlesungen speichern möchten. In diesem Artikel beschreiben wir die Installation von Ubuntu-Anwendungen auf Ubuntu24. Aktualisieren des Ubuntu-Systems Vor der Installation des Ubuntu-Installationsprogramms müssen wir auf Ubuntu24 sicherstellen, dass das neu konfigurierte System aktualisiert wurde. Wir können das bekannteste „a“ im Ubuntu-System verwenden

Detaillierte Schritte zur Installation der Go-Sprache auf einem Win7-Computer. Go (auch bekannt als Golang) ist eine von Google entwickelte Open-Source-Programmiersprache. Sie ist einfach, effizient und bietet eine hervorragende Parallelitätsleistung. Sie eignet sich für die Entwicklung von Cloud-Diensten, Netzwerkanwendungen usw Back-End-Systeme. Durch die Installation der Go-Sprache auf einem Win7-Computer können Sie schnell mit der Sprache beginnen und mit dem Schreiben von Go-Programmen beginnen. Im Folgenden werden die Schritte zur Installation der Go-Sprache auf einem Win7-Computer im Detail vorgestellt und spezifische Codebeispiele angehängt. Schritt 1: Laden Sie das Go-Sprachinstallationspaket herunter und besuchen Sie die offizielle Go-Website

Die Installation der Go-Sprache unter dem Win7-System ist ein relativ einfacher Vorgang. Befolgen Sie einfach die folgenden Schritte, um sie erfolgreich zu installieren. Im Folgenden wird detailliert beschrieben, wie die Go-Sprache unter dem Win7-System installiert wird. Schritt 1: Laden Sie das Go-Sprachinstallationspaket herunter. Öffnen Sie zunächst die offizielle Go-Sprache-Website (https://golang.org/) und rufen Sie die Download-Seite auf. Wählen Sie auf der Download-Seite die Version des Installationspakets aus, die mit dem Win7-System kompatibel ist und heruntergeladen werden soll. Klicken Sie auf die Download-Schaltfläche und warten Sie, bis das Installationspaket heruntergeladen ist. Schritt 2: Installieren Sie die Go-Sprache
